零知識證明(ZKPs)作爲區塊鏈領域的一項突破性技術,正在徹底改變隱私和可擴展性。ZK,即區塊鏈中的“零知識”的縮寫,是一種加密方法,允許一方向另一方證明某個陳述是真實的,而無需透露任何額外信息。這項技術近年來獲得了顯著的關注,在Web3生態系統的各個領域都有衆多應用。
ZK技術的實施在我們處理區塊鏈網路中的隱私和數據安全方面帶來了範式轉變。通過使用戶能夠驗證交易並執行智能合約而不披露敏感信息,零知識證明解決了加密領域中最緊迫的擔憂之一:透明性與隱私之間的權衡。這一突破爲更安全和高效的區塊鏈系統鋪平了道路,吸引了開發者和投資者的關注。
ZK技術最顯著的影響之一是它在增強區塊鏈網路可擴展性方面的作用,特別是以太坊. ZK Rollup,一個利用零知識證明的擴展解決方案,已在解決以太坊擁堵問題中發揮了重要作用。通過在鏈下處理交易並僅將有效性證明提交給主鏈,ZK Rollup顯著提高了交易吞吐量,同時保持了基礎層的安全性保證。這導致了燃氣費用的降低和確認時間的縮短,使以太坊對更廣泛的用戶和應用程序變得更加可訪問。
理解零知識證明的工作原理可能具有挑戰性,因爲其中涉及復雜的數學。然而,核心概念可以通過一個簡單的類比來解釋。想象一下一個色盲的朋友,他有兩個不同顏色的球,但無法區分它們。你,作爲一個能看見顏色的人,想向你的朋友證明這些球確實是不同的,而不透露哪個是哪個。
爲了證明這一點,你讓你的朋友把球藏在他們的背後並隨機給你展示一個。你每次都能正確識別它的顏色。通過多次重復這個過程,你的朋友相信這些球的顏色是不同的,而從未知道哪個球是哪個顏色。這就是零知識證明的本質:證明知識而不揭示知識本身。
在區塊鏈的背景下,零知識證明允許在不披露基礎數據的情況下驗證交易或計算。這是通過復雜的加密算法實現的,這些算法生成的證明可以被網路上的任何人快速驗證。零知識證明的美妙之處在於它們在確保區塊鏈完整性的同時保持隱私。
零知識證明應用迅速擴展,在區塊鏈行業的各個領域找到了應用場景。以下是五個正在改變行業格局的顯著應用:
隱私保護的加密貨幣:像這樣的幣Zcash利用零知識證明(ZK-SNARKs)實現完全加密的交易,爲用戶提供完全的財務隱私。
去中心化身份驗證:零知識證明允許用戶在不透露敏感個人信息的情況下證明他們的身分或憑證,從而增強KYC流程中的隱私。
安全投票系統:基於區塊鏈的投票平台利用零知識證明(ZKPs)確保投票的完整性和選民的匿名性。
保密智能合約:零知識證明技術使得智能合約能夠執行私密輸入,爲去中心化金融和企業區塊鏈解決方案開闢了新的可能性。
可擴展的去中心化交易所:零知識證明匯總已在去中心化交易所中實施,以提高交易速度並降低費用,同時保持安全性。
這些應用展示了零知識證明在解決區塊鏈領域關鍵挑戰方面的多樣性和潛力,從隱私問題到可擴展性問題。
ZK rollups 已成爲以太坊擴展挑戰的突破性解決方案。通過將多個交易打包成一個單一的證明,並僅將此證明發布到主鏈,ZK rollups 顯著提高了網路的吞吐量。這種方法相較於其他擴展解決方案提供了幾個優勢:
特徵 | ZK Rollups | 樂觀匯總 | Plasma |
---|---|---|---|
交易最終性 | 即時 | 1-2周 | 變量 |
隱私 | 高 | 低 | 中等 |
可擴展性 | 非常高 | 高 | 中等 |
兼容性 | 限制 | 高 | 有限 |
ZK rollups 提供近乎即時的交易最終性,因爲發布到主鏈的有效性證明是加密可驗證的。這消除了與樂觀匯總相關的長時間挑戰期。此外,零知識證明的隱私保護特性使得 ZK rollups 成爲需要保密的應用的一個有吸引力的選擇。
ZK rollups 的可擴展性優勢是顯著的。目前的實現已經展示了每秒處理數千筆交易的能力,這比以太坊的基礎層容量有了顯著改善。這種增加的吞吐量導致了燃氣費用的降低和用戶體驗的提升,使以太坊對更廣泛的用戶和應用程序變得更加可訪問。
隨着以太坊生態系統的不斷增長,零知識證明(ZK)匯總在其擴展策略中發揮着至關重要的作用。包括Gate在內的主要項目和交易所已經開始集成ZK匯總技術,以便爲用戶提供更快、更便宜的交易,同時保持以太坊主網的安全保障。ZK匯總的持續發展和採用預計將是以太坊滿足去中心化金融(DeFi)和Web3領域不斷增長需求的關鍵因素。